Output 5c86eb7516aa7941264415ff4daf1af72aa4a3c2904ef802aa3be63752026c1d:0

value
1675320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3e9af4ac7e0094aeae7592e870786845e9bbda OP_EQUAL
address
3MmZadzj1yHEDF6fAVZZeHQ5okk8RcbprK
transaction
5c86eb7516aa7941264415ff4daf1af72aa4a3c2904ef802aa3be63752026c1d
spent
true